8.1.4 Automatic starting
- Move the speed/gear box lever into neutral position by means of the
control lever.
- Turn the switch to energize the starting motor.
Release immediately, if the engine start and it will return to position “O”.
The alarm light as well as the buzzer should now be off.
- If the engine should fail to start, due to poor battery condition, turn the
battery switch to the second start battery and repeat the starting procedure.
- If the engine fail to start in 15 seconds, despite good battery condition,
release the switch and investigate the cause. The starting motor should be
allowed to cool for at least 15 seconds before attempting to restart.
- At low temperature it may be necessary to ease the starting by means
of the start gas.
The operational method is shown as follows:
- open the dust cover of the liquid storage. insert the pouring liquid
pressure can into the hole of the liquid storage. Squeeze the can to pour the
liquid into liquid storage.
- Set the gear box at idle position and put the handle of fuel rack at mid-
position.
- Start the engine. At the same time, operate the hand-pump until the
engine runs stably.
